ioBroker.admin icon indicating copy to clipboard operation
ioBroker.admin copied to clipboard

[bug]: Der Eintrag Systemeinstellungen kann nicht geöffnet werden

Open SpezialAgent opened this issue 9 months ago • 12 comments

No existing issues.

  • [x] There is no existing issue for my problem.

Describe the bug

Ich betreibe 3 ioBroker Server. Ein Produktivsystem bestehend aus einem Master (VM unter Proxmox) und einem Slave (Raspi 5) sowie ein Testsystem als VM unter Proxmox.

Das Prod.System läuft im Stable Repo, das Testsystem läuft im Latest-Repo.

Seit einiger Zeit (ich kann die Zeit nicht genau festlegen, aber größer als eine Woche)) kann ich bei beiden System die Systemeinstellungen (Schraubenschlüssel) nicht mehr öffnen: Es kommt der Fehler: "Cannot read settings: Error: Timeout"

Da ich die Einstellungen nicht täglich öffne, kann ich den Zeitpunkt der Fehlfunktion nicht bestimmen.

Ich habe das Testsystem neu erstellt und ein Backup eingespielt. Der Fehler ist aber immer noch vorhanden.

Die Einstellungen kann mit CLI Commands ändern: Bsp.: iobroker object get system.config iobroker object set system.config common.language=de

Auch den History Adapter konnte ich eintragen.

Ein Backup hat den Sachverhalt nicht geändert. Scheinbar ist der Fehler schon im Backup. Eine weitere frisch aufgesetzte Maschine mit ioBroker lässt sich konfigurieren. Spiele ich das Backup ein, so ist der Fehler wieder da.

Hier der Thread im Forum: https://forum.iobroker.net/topic/79641/eintrag-systemeinstellungen-kann-nicht-geöffnet-werden Als Anhang das komplette Diagnostic-File

diag.txt

To Reproduce

  1. Iobroker GUI starten
  2. Schraubenschlüssel in der Top-Zeile anklicken
  3. Error: "Cannot read settings: Error: Timeout"
  4. Endlosschleife

Expected behavior

Alle Adapter update iob upload all

iob restore 0

Screenshots & Logfiles

Image Image

Adapter version

Admin 7.4.19

js-controller version

7.0.6

Node version

20.18.2

Operating system

Debian 12.9

Additional context

Das Problem liegt auch in meinem Produktion System vor. Alle Adapter Stable außer Shuttercontrol, Alarm eCharts Auch Debian 12.9

SpezialAgent avatar Feb 05 '25 20:02 SpezialAgent

Hatte ich Anfang der Woche auch mal. Ist aber mittlerweile wie von Zauberhand wieder OK.

Image

DEV2DEV-DE avatar Feb 05 '25 20:02 DEV2DEV-DE

Ich hatte schon die Hoffnung, dass es auch bei meinen Systemen funktioniert 😞

Leider funktioniert es auf beiden Systemen (Prod. == Stable) und (Test==Latest/Beta) nicht.

SpezialAgent avatar Feb 05 '25 20:02 SpezialAgent

@SpezialAgent Hat ein update auf die aktuelle admin stable Version eine Verbesserung gebracht? Hast du schon einmal auf der Konsole ein iob fix ausgeführt?

Feuer-sturm avatar Apr 24 '25 07:04 Feuer-sturm

Ich habe die VIS2 deinstalliert. Seit dem funktioniert es. Ich habe es auch parallel im Testsystem (Latest) durchgeführt. Dort ist das Verhalten reproduzierbar: Mit VIS2 kann die Einstellungen nicht öffnen, entferne ich die VIS2 bei ansonsten gleichen Einstellungen, öffnen dich die Einstellungen wieder. Ich habe es aber nicht mit der neuesten Admin aus dem Latest (7.6.14) getestet. Das mache ich nachher. P.S. ioBroker fix mache ich bei solchen Tests immer.

SpezialAgent avatar Apr 24 '25 08:04 SpezialAgent

@Feuer-sturm

Ich habe den Test doch noch schnell gemacht. Einstellungen funktioniert. VIS-2 installiert: Einstellungen lässt sich nicht mehr öffnen. VIS-2 deinstalliert: Einstellungen lässt sich wieder öffnen. Es war kein Neustart oder iob fix nötig.

SpezialAgent avatar Apr 24 '25 08:04 SpezialAgent

@SpezialAgent Welche Version von vis-2 hast du installiert? Schau mal in die Konsole (F12) ob dort dann Fehler oder Warnungen kommen, wenn du bei installiertem vis-2 die Einstellungen zu öffnen

Feuer-sturm avatar Apr 24 '25 08:04 Feuer-sturm

@Feuer-sturm Das ist die latest 2.11.2

get state: false bootstrap-DlPDCLBt.js:16 Cannot read settings: Error: timeout (anonymous) @ bootstrap-DlPDCLBt.js:16 App.window.alert @ bootstrap-DlPDCLBt.js:2003 getSettings @ bootstrap-DlPDCLBt.js:1934 await in getSettings SystemSettingsDialog @ bootstrap-DlPDCLBt.js:1934 Gs @ index-Bsv_DXxB.js:22 ao @ index-Bsv_DXxB.js:24 ya @ index-Bsv_DXxB.js:24 va @ index-Bsv_DXxB.js:24 kc @ index-Bsv_DXxB.js:24 Qr @ index-Bsv_DXxB.js:24 wo @ index-Bsv_DXxB.js:24 dn @ index-Bsv_DXxB.js:22 (anonymous) @ index-Bsv_DXxB.js:24 hashchange doNavigate @ bootstrap-DlPDCLBt.js:247 onClick @ bootstrap-DlPDCLBt.js:2003 Va @ index-Bsv_DXxB.js:21 Ha @ index-Bsv_DXxB.js:21 Qa @ index-Bsv_DXxB.js:21 Hi @ index-Bsv_DXxB.js:21 ys @ index-Bsv_DXxB.js:21 (anonymous) @ index-Bsv_DXxB.js:21 si @ index-Bsv_DXxB.js:24 Ho @ index-Bsv_DXxB.js:21 Cl @ index-Bsv_DXxB.js:21 Iu @ index-Bsv_DXxB.js:21 uf @ index-Bsv_DXxB.js:21 r @ bootstrap-DlPDCLBt.js:16Understand this error 2bootstrap-DlPDCLBt.js:16 get state: false

SpezialAgent avatar Apr 24 '25 08:04 SpezialAgent

@SpezialAgent Ok, dann muss @GermanBluefox einmal schauen. Bei mir habe ich keine Probleme mit admin 6.7.14 + vis2 v2.11.2 beim öffnen der Einstellungen.

Hast du es auch einmal mit einem anderen Browser / Cache löschen / Inkognito-Modus versucht?

Feuer-sturm avatar Apr 24 '25 08:04 Feuer-sturm

@Feuer-sturm Ja, habe es diesmal mit Chrome versucht. Vorher mit Safari .

SpezialAgent avatar Apr 24 '25 08:04 SpezialAgent

@Feuer-sturm Ich habe jetzt mal den iob gestoppt, iob fix und danach wieder iob start. Ergebnis: Funktioniert leider immer noch nicht.

SpezialAgent avatar Apr 24 '25 09:04 SpezialAgent

Geh mal in den Admin-Adapter-Einstellungen. Dort dann "Nicht überprüfen, ob diese Instanz aus dem Internet errreichbar ist" aktivieren. Beim mir hat das geholfen und ich kann die Systemeinstellungen wieder aufrufen.

Joppevilla avatar May 27 '25 09:05 Joppevilla

Das funktioniert leider auch nicht. Wenn ich die VIS-2 installiere, dann komme ich nicht mehr in die Einstellung. Und das unabhängig von der Admin Einstellung "Erreichbarkeit Internet....". Wenn ich die VIS-2 wieder deinstallieren, dann lupft es wieder.

SpezialAgent avatar May 28 '25 09:05 SpezialAgent